Guest guest Posted June 11, 2006 Report Share Posted June 11, 2006 *Sprouts* Preparing Sprouts can be one of the easiest and least expensive ways to add Veg. Protein and Vitamins and Minerals. The Seeds for sprouting can be purchased in either a Health Food Store or in Supermarket. Seeds best for sprouting; *Alfafa Seeds; Mung Beans; Lentils; Adukzi-Beans Sun-flower Seeds etc.* Put Seeds in Sieve and Rinse well under Cold Water; set aside to drain. Take any Glass Jar; such as Mayonaise or Pickle. The large Fruit Salad Jars are the best. Wash Jar in Hot Soapy Water Rinse well in hot H20. Pour a small amount of water in Jar; add Seeds; Cover for few hours. Strain Seeds into Sieve from Jar; Rinse with Cold Water; rinse Jar. Pour rinsed soaked Seeds back into Jar; do not add more Water. Set Jar in a Cool dark place with cheese cloth and rubber band on top. In 24 hours the Seed begin to Sprout; Rinse seeds 1 or 2 times daily. When the Spouts are 1 " or longer Harvest by Rinsing under Cold H20. Tip: After Seeds begin to Sprout place Jar in Sun to develop leaves. Add Spruts to Salads Soups Sandwiches.
